项目测试部门的管理是个复杂的任务,它包括了对测试团队的管理、测试流程的设计和执行、测试环境的搭建和维护、测试工具的选择和应用、测试计划的编制和实施、测试结果的分析和报告等多个方面。一、测试团队的建设和管理、二、测试流程的设计和执行、三、测试环境的搭建和维护、四、测试工具的选择和应用、五、测试计划的编制和实施、六、测试结果的分析和报告,这些都是测试部门管理的重要任务。下面我们将详细讨论一下其中的第一点:测试团队的建设和管理。
一、测试团队的建设和管理
测试团队的建设和管理是测试部门管理的基础,也是最重要的一环。测试团队的建设主要包括人员的招聘、培训和发展,而测试团队的管理则包括团队的组织、沟通、激励和评价。
-
人员的招聘:招聘是建设测试团队的第一步,也是非常关键的一步。因为,只有招到合适的人,才能建设出高效的团队。在招聘时,不仅要考虑应聘者的专业技能,还要考虑他们的沟通能力、学习能力和团队合作能力。
-
人员的培训和发展:招到合适的人后,就需要进行培训和发展。培训可以提升团队成员的专业技能,而发展则可以帮助他们实现职业生涯的规划。
-
团队的组织:测试团队的组织形式有很多种,比如按项目组织、按产品组织、按技术组织等。不同的组织形式有不同的优点和缺点,需要根据实际情况来选择。
-
团队的沟通:沟通是团队协作的基础,只有良好的沟通,才能保证团队的高效运行。在团队中,需要建立起有效的沟通机制,包括日常的会议、报告、邮件等。
-
团队的激励和评价:激励和评价是管理团队的重要手段。通过激励,可以激发团队成员的工作热情,通过评价,可以了解团队成员的工作表现,从而进行适当的调整。
二、测试流程的设计和执行
测试流程的设计和执行是测试部门管理的核心任务之一。好的测试流程可以保证测试的质量和效率,也可以减少测试的风险。
-
测试流程的设计:测试流程的设计需要考虑很多因素,比如项目的特性、团队的能力、测试的目标等。设计好的测试流程应该包括测试计划的制定、测试用例的设计、测试的执行、测试结果的分析和报告等步骤。
-
测试流程的执行:测试流程的执行需要严格按照设计的流程来进行,不能随意改变。在执行过程中,需要注意的是,测试的目标不是找到尽可能多的缺陷,而是保证产品的质量。
三、测试环境的搭建和维护
测试环境的搭建和维护是测试部门管理的重要任务之一。好的测试环境可以提高测试的效率,也可以减少测试的风险。
-
测试环境的搭建:测试环境的搭建需要考虑很多因素,比如产品的特性、测试的目标、团队的能力等。搭建好的测试环境应该包括硬件环境、软件环境和数据环境。
-
测试环境的维护:测试环境的维护是一个持续的过程,需要定期检查和更新。在维护过程中,需要注意的是,测试环境应该尽可能接近实际的使用环境。
四、测试工具的选择和应用
测试工具的选择和应用是测试部门管理的重要任务之一。好的测试工具可以提高测试的效率,也可以减少测试的风险。
-
测试工具的选择:测试工具的选择需要考虑很多因素,比如产品的特性、测试的目标、团队的能力等。选择好的测试工具应该能够满足测试的需求,而且易于使用。
-
测试工具的应用:测试工具的应用需要熟练掌握工具的使用方法,才能发挥工具的效能。在应用过程中,需要注意的是,工具只是辅助,真正的决定因素还是测试人员的技能。
五、测试计划的编制和实施
测试计划的编制和实施是测试部门管理的重要任务之一。好的测试计划可以保证测试的质量和效率,也可以减少测试的风险。
-
测试计划的编制:测试计划的编制需要考虑很多因素,比如项目的特性、测试的目标、团队的能力等。编制好的测试计划应该包括测试的目标、测试的范围、测试的方法、测试的资源、测试的进度等内容。
-
测试计划的实施:测试计划的实施需要严格按照计划来进行,不能随意改变。在实施过程中,需要注意的是,测试的目标不是找到尽可能多的缺陷,而是保证产品的质量。
六、测试结果的分析和报告
测试结果的分析和报告是测试部门管理的重要任务之一。好的测试结果的分析和报告可以帮助项目团队了解产品的质量,也可以帮助测试部门改进测试的方法。
-
测试结果的分析:测试结果的分析需要考虑很多因素,比如缺陷的严重性、缺陷的数量、缺陷的分布等。分析好的测试结果应该能够反映产品的质量,也能够反映测试的效果。
-
测试结果的报告:测试结果的报告需要清楚、准确、完整地描述测试的情况,包括测试的过程、测试的结果、测试的分析等。报告好的测试结果可以帮助项目团队了解产品的质量,也可以帮助测试部门改进测试的方法。
在实施项目测试部门的管理时,可以使用项目管理系统来协助,比如研发项目管理系统PingCode和通用项目管理软件Worktile。这两个系统都有强大的功能,可以帮助你更好地管理测试部门。
相关问答FAQs:
1. 项目测试部门的管理方式有哪些?
项目测试部门的管理方式包括但不限于以下几种:团队管理、任务分配、进度跟踪、质量控制、沟通协作等。
2. 项目测试部门如何有效地进行团队管理?
为了有效地进行团队管理,项目测试部门可以采取以下措施:设定明确的团队目标,制定合理的工作计划,建立良好的沟通渠道,提供必要的培训和技术支持,激励团队成员积极参与等。
3. 项目测试部门如何进行任务分配和进度跟踪?
项目测试部门可以通过以下方式进行任务分配和进度跟踪:根据项目需求和团队成员的能力进行任务分配,明确任务的优先级和截止日期,使用项目管理工具或项目跟踪系统进行进度跟踪,及时与团队成员进行沟通和协调,确保任务按时完成。
文章标题:项目测试部门如何管理,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3279389